| Learn & Live is an
independent voice in road safety and is not tied to any other organisation nor
to any driver instruction organisation. Although Learn and Live is a UK-based organisation, it has already forged links with individuals and organisations across the world and is particularly pleased to receive information on related road safety issues from other countries. |
